【Win11 SolidWorks2022安装破解】无法连接到服务器(-15,10,10061)或者是.bat文件运行闪退可能的解决方法


前言

在电脑重装完Win11系统之后,需要安装SolidWorks2022。我是按照溪风博客提供的安装包和教程进行操作,其安装教程和破解方法的链接如下:

  https://xifengboke.com/post/1658.html

一般来说,按照教程的步骤能够正常安装和破解完成,在之前的几次安装sw中我也没出现过问题。

但是在这一次安装过程中,我以管理员身份运行server_install.bat和server_remove.bat时界面只是一闪而过(.bat文件运行闪退)。
闪退

如果此时按照教程的步骤继续安装(我第一次安装就是这样),那么最终安装的sw2022将破解失败不能够正常运行,有可能出现无法连接到服务器(-15,10,10061)的警告。

这是我第一次安装的结果,显示无法连接到服务器。


一、网上查找的解决方法

1. 启动Windows installer服务

相关链接:

https://www.zhihu.com/question/561130816

解决方法:
(上面提到的链接中的操作系统是win10,这里我将其改为win11下的操作)
1.右击[此电脑],点击[显示更多选项],再点击[管理];
2.打开的界面中,双击[服务和应用程序];
3.打开的界面中双击[服务];
4.再按照链接的步骤,找到[Windows Installer],并启动它。

结果:没有作用

2. 将电脑名改为英文

相关链接:

https://blog.csdn.net/m0_72976761/article/details/131638283

解决方法:
设置-系统-系统信息-重命名这台电脑,修改为英文名(不要有空格或其他符号)
(注意:电脑名称是设备名称,不是微软账户名,也不是c盘里的用户名)

结果:
本人电脑的设备名称
因为本人的电脑名称已经是英文名了(如上图所示),所以不是这个问题。但是名称不能有其他符号的问题给了我启发,会不会就是下载的安装包名称有问题,导致破解失败?顺着这个思路,得到最终的解决方法。


二、最终解决方法

1. 将sw2022安装包/破解包的名称改为英文

第一次解压时文件夹的名称有特殊符号
因为这是我第二次将安装包保存在百度网盘中,百度网盘在文件夹名称后自动添加了“(2)”
第一次解压后安装包的名称
需要新建一个文件夹,注意新建文件夹的名称为英文名称(如sw)
新建文件夹为英文名称
将原文件夹中的_SolidSQUAD_.zip压缩包复制并解压到新建的文件夹(sw)中
sw文件夹内容

2. 重新进行sw2022破解

出现打开安装完的sw2022后弹出无法连接到服务器(-15,10,10061)警告,不需要卸载已经安装完成的sw2022软件,只需要将溪风博客安装教程的一部分步骤重新执行一遍即可。
1、打开sw文件夹中的_SolidSQUAD_文件夹,双击注册表sw2022_network_serials_licensing.reg
2、打开_SolidSQUAD_/SolidWorks_Flexnet_Server文件夹,右键以管理员身份运行server_remove.bat,执行相关操作
3、打开_SolidSQUAD_/SolidWorks_Flexnet_Server文件夹,右键以管理员身份运行server_install.bat,执行相关操作
4、打开sw文件夹中的_SolidSQUAD_文件夹,双击注册表SolidSQUADLoaderEnabler.reg
5、将_SolidSQUAD_文件夹中的Program Files文件夹复制到C盘(安装sw2022中指定的安装路径,可能不是C盘)
6、打开sw2022,能够正常运行
sw2022界面


总结

在Win11操作系统中,安装破解SolidWorks2022出现无法连接到服务器(-15,10,10061)或者是.bat文件运行闪退可能的解决方法:
1.将安装包(破解包)文件夹的名称改为英文
2.重新执行部分破解步骤
以上,即可完成破解。

### 解决SOLIDWORKS Standard启动时无法获得许可证并无法连接到服务器方法 对于SOLIDWORKS Standard在启动时报错,提示无法获得许可并且显示特定错误码的情况,存在两种主要场景及其对应的解决方案。 #### 场景一:错误代码 (-16,287,0) 当遇到此错误时,表明客户端尝试从许可管理器获取授权失败。可能的原因包括网络配置不当、服务未正常运行或是防火墙阻止了必要的通信。针对这种情况,建议执行以下操作来排查和解决问题: - 验证计算机能够访问许可服务器,并确认两者之间的网络路径畅通无阻。 - 检查本地主机上的Windows服务列表中是否有FLEXnet Licensing Service正在运行;如果没有,则需启动该服务[^1]。 #### 场景二:错误代码 (15,10,10061) 这个错误通常意味着应用程序试图建立与许可服务器的TCP/IP会话但未能成功。具体表现为拒绝连接的状态。处理措施如下所示: - 访问包含SolidWorks浮动许可证管理工具包的位置——即solidworks_Flexnet_server目录下。 - 使用管理员权限依次执行`server_remove.bat`脚本以卸载现有组件,随后再通过相同方式运行`server_install.bat`完成重新部署过程[^2]。 ```batch @echo off :: Example of running batch files with administrative privileges. runas /user:Administrator "path\to\your\file.bat" ``` 以上步骤有助于修复由于安装不完全或其他未知因素引起的许可验证机制失效状况。如果上述方法仍不能有效解除问题,考虑联系官方技术支持团队寻求进一步帮助可能是明智的选择。
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值